Transponder Keys

Transponder keys must be programmed correctly to begin the vehicle. A standard transponder key appears like a standard metal key with a plastic cover (like the one above). Inside is a microchip which sends an electronic signal to your vehicle every time you insert it into the ignition. If the signal is matched the one you received, your car will begin. This technology was created to deter theft of cars. It has proven to be a huge success - the number vehicles stolen has significantly decreased since the introduction of this technology.

To get a new transponder keys will require you to take your vehicle to a specialist. In general, you'll need to visit your local locksmith for automotive or dealer. If you go to the dealership, it's more expensive since they have to pair your new key with your particular vehicle. If you have a spare key with transponder, you will be able to avoid a trip to a dealer.

The majority times, you will be able to find a replacement key at your local automotive store or at the nearest AutoZone location. They will be able to cut the key and then program it with an instrument that is specifically designed for this purpose. This will help you save the cost of going to the dealer, and could even assist you in avoiding towing fees!

The primary reason to have a transponder key is to deter car theft. Before, thieves could put the key in the ignition and then turn it on using a method known as hot wiring. This was a simple method for thieves since they only needed to connect the two wires of the car and the keys. However after the introduction of transponder keys this became much more difficult to carry out.

Transponder keys are an excellent way to protect your car from theft. The reason is that the transponder can stop your car from starting if it isn't programmed to match the signal that the key sends to the vehicle. This will stop thieves from hot wiring your vehicle and make it harder for them to steal your car.
